⚖️ Bill S-211 - Fighting Against Forced Labour and Child Labour in Supply Chains Act

Status: ✅ Effective May 31, 2024 (Fully Compliant)

WarmHub Compliance Measures:

  • Annual Supply Chain Report: Published by May 31 each year, detailing steps taken to prevent and reduce forced labour risks
  • Supplier Audits: All manufacturing partners undergo annual third-party audits for labour compliance
  • Due Diligence Framework: Risk assessment of all suppliers in accordance with UN Guiding Principles on Business and Human Rights
  • Whistleblower Protection: Confidential reporting mechanism for supply chain labour concerns
  • Training Programs: Annual training for procurement team on forced labour indicators and prevention

Our Certification: WarmHub certifies that our products are manufactured in facilities that prohibit forced labour, child labour, and human trafficking. Our 2025 transparency report is available upon request.

🌐 CARM - Canada Assessment and Revenue Management

Status: ✅ Fully Implemented October 21, 2024 (Compliant)

Key Changes for B2B Importers:

  • Mandatory CARM Client Portal (CCP) account for all commercial importers
  • Financial security requirements: Importers must post security deposits based on import volume (typically 1-3 months of duties/taxes)
  • Electronic B3 declarations: All customs entries must be submitted electronically through CCP
  • Real-time account management: View duty/tax balances, payment history, and compliance status online
  • Strengthened enforcement: Enhanced CBSA audits and penalties for non-compliance

WarmHub Support: We provide CARM-compliant electronic documentation, assist with CCP registration, and ensure accurate HS code classification to minimize audit risks.

💰 Digital Services Tax (DST)

Status: ✅ In Effect June 28, 2024 (Monitored)

Impact on WarmHub: DST applies to large digital platforms with annual revenue exceeding CAD $20 million from digital services and CAD $1.125 billion globally. As a B2B wholesale supplier focused on physical products, WarmHub does not meet DST thresholds and is not subject to DST.

Note for E-commerce Clients: If you resell WarmHub products through large digital marketplaces (e.g., Amazon.ca), you may be indirectly affected by DST passed through platform fees. Please consult your tax advisor.
